Title: The Innovations of Takayuki Fudo
Introduction
Takayuki Fudo is a prominent inventor based in Toyama, Japan. He has made significant contributions to the field of materials science, particularly in the development of tungsten carbide powders. With a total of six patents to his name, Fudo's work has had a considerable impact on various industrial applications.
Latest Patents
Fudo's latest patents include innovative methods for producing tungsten carbide powder. One notable patent describes a tungsten carbide powder that contains tungsten carbide as a main component and chromium. This powder is characterized by a standard deviation of 0.5 or less in the distribution of the ratio of chromium concentration to the total concentration of tungsten and chromium, measured at 100 or more analysis points. Another patent focuses on a tungsten carbide powder that includes bonded bodies, each containing multiple tungsten carbide crystal grains. These bonded bodies feature a chromium-concentrated region at the grain boundary, which has a higher chromium concentration than the tungsten carbide crystal grains.
Career Highlights
Throughout his career, Takayuki Fudo has worked with notable companies such as Sumitomo Electric Industries, Limited and A.L.M.T. Corporation. His experience in these organizations has allowed him to refine his expertise in materials development and innovation.
Collaborations
Fudo has collaborated with several talented individuals in his field, including Kazuo Sasaya and Takehiko Hayashi. These partnerships have contributed to the advancement of his research and the successful development of his patented technologies.
